WebIt consists of primary, secondary, and tertiary colors. 1. Contrast of hue. The easiest way to achieve contrast is to apply clear, intense colors side by side, using the three primary and three secondary colors. The most basic and sharpest contrast is between the three primary colors, red, yellow, and blue. WebGirl With A Pearl Earring – Johannes Vermeer (1665), Oil. Vermeer uses earthly colours, with a blue adjacent acting as a compliment to the warm colours. Vermeer is the perfect artist to begin this famous colour palettes collection. A dark blue-grey background surrounds the figure, with a warm and earthy colour palette used for the figure. WebApr 6, 2024 · Art Institute of Chicago. Nighthawks by Edward Hopper is among the most iconic paintings of American culture, serving as a virtual capture of the lifestyle in the 1940s. The piece is an oil painting depicting a late-evening scenario in which a few customers are still hanging around a diner.

WebContrast is the positioning of opposing components in a work of art. It occurs when two or more related elements are strikingly different—the greater the difference, the greater the contrast. Opposing Elements in Art. The key to working with contrast is to make sure the differences are apparent.
